Output fbd12254fb5792e62fd0c1ab6d658d1036a18b52612b4f3de66364d45cf7a815:13

value
2611219
script pubkey
OP_0 OP_PUSHBYTES_20 291d8cc8113a52c414e0105f985b61993ce68b55
address
bc1q9ywcejq38ffvg98qzp0eskmpny7wdz64rtr70e
transaction
fbd12254fb5792e62fd0c1ab6d658d1036a18b52612b4f3de66364d45cf7a815
confirmations
193096
spent
true